Benefits of Using Wire Rope Sling Legs in Overhead Crane Operations

Wire rope sling legs are an essential component in overhead crane operations, providing support and stability for lifting heavy loads. These sling legs are made from high-strength steel wire ropes that are designed to withstand the rigors of lifting and moving heavy objects. In this article, we will explore the benefits of using wire rope sling legs in overhead crane operations.

One of the key benefits of using wire rope sling legs is their strength and durability. These sling legs are constructed from multiple strands of steel wire that are twisted together to form a strong and flexible rope. This construction allows the sling legs to support heavy loads without stretching or breaking, ensuring the Safety of both the load and the workers involved in the lifting operation.

In addition to their strength, wire rope sling legs are also highly resistant to abrasion and corrosion. This makes them ideal for use in harsh environments where exposure to moisture, Chemicals, or abrasive materials could compromise the integrity of the sling legs. By using wire rope sling legs, operators can ensure that their lifting operations are safe and reliable, even in challenging conditions.

Another benefit of using wire rope sling legs in overhead crane operations is their versatility. These sling legs can be easily adjusted to accommodate different load sizes and shapes, making them suitable for a wide range of lifting applications. Whether lifting a small, delicate object or a large, heavy load, wire rope sling legs can be customized to provide the necessary support and stability.

Furthermore, wire rope sling legs are easy to inspect and maintain, ensuring that they remain in optimal condition for safe lifting operations. Regular inspections can help identify any signs of wear or damage, allowing operators to address any issues before they become a safety hazard. By properly maintaining their wire rope sling legs, operators can extend the lifespan of these essential lifting components and ensure the continued safety of their crane operations.

In conclusion, wire rope sling legs are a valuable asset in overhead crane operations, providing strength, durability, versatility, and ease of maintenance. By using wire rope sling legs, operators can ensure the safety and efficiency of their lifting operations, even in challenging environments. With their ability to support heavy loads, resist abrasion and corrosion, and adapt to different lifting requirements, wire rope sling legs are an essential component in any overhead crane system.Operators who prioritize safety and reliability in their lifting operations should consider the benefits of using wire rope sling legs for their overhead crane operations.

Proper Inspection and Maintenance of Wire Rope Sling Legs for Overhead Crane Safety

Wire rope sling legs are an essential component of overhead cranes, providing the necessary support and stability for lifting heavy loads. These sling legs are made up of multiple strands of wire rope that are twisted together to form a strong and durable lifting device. However, like any other piece of equipment, wire rope sling legs require regular inspection and maintenance to ensure their safe and efficient operation.

Proper inspection of wire rope sling legs is crucial to identify any signs of wear, damage, or fatigue that could compromise their strength and integrity. Before each use, it is important to visually inspect the sling legs for any kinks, twists, or broken wires. Any such defects should be immediately addressed to prevent the risk of failure during lifting operations.

In addition to visual inspections, periodic thorough examinations of wire rope sling legs should be conducted by qualified personnel to assess their overall condition. This involves measuring the diameter of the wire rope, checking for signs of corrosion or rust, and inspecting the end fittings for any signs of wear or deformation. Any abnormalities should be documented and addressed according to the manufacturer’s recommendations.

Regular maintenance of wire rope sling legs is also essential to prolong their service life and ensure safe operation. This includes lubricating the wire rope to reduce friction and wear, as well as storing the sling legs properly to prevent damage and deterioration. Proper storage of wire rope sling legs involves keeping them off the ground, away from moisture and chemicals, and in a dry and well-ventilated area.

When using wire rope sling legs for overhead crane operations, it is important to follow safe lifting practices to prevent accidents and injuries. This includes ensuring that the load is properly balanced and secured, using the correct lifting capacity for the sling legs, and avoiding sudden movements or jerks during lifting. It is also important to never exceed the working load limit of the sling legs, as this can Lead to catastrophic failure and serious consequences.

In the event of any damage or wear to wire rope sling legs, it is important to take immediate action to repair or replace the affected components. This may involve splicing the wire rope, replacing damaged strands, or installing new end fittings to ensure the safe and reliable operation of the sling legs. It is important to follow the manufacturer’s recommendations and guidelines for repair and replacement to maintain the integrity and strength of the sling legs.

In conclusion, proper inspection and maintenance of wire rope sling legs are essential for ensuring the safe and efficient operation of overhead cranes. By conducting regular visual inspections, thorough examinations, and following safe lifting practices, operators can prevent accidents and injuries, prolong the service life of the sling legs, and ensure the safety of lifting operations. By following these guidelines and best practices, operators can maintain the integrity and reliability of wire rope sling legs for overhead crane safety.

Common Mistakes to Avoid When Using Wire Rope Sling Legs in Overhead Crane Applications

Wire rope sling legs are a crucial component in overhead crane applications, providing support and stability for lifting heavy loads. However, there are common mistakes that can occur when using wire rope sling legs that can compromise safety and efficiency. In this article, we will discuss some of these mistakes and provide tips on how to avoid them.

One common mistake when using wire rope sling legs in overhead crane applications is overloading the sling. It is important to know the weight capacity of the sling and ensure that it is not exceeded. Overloading can cause the sling to fail, leading to serious accidents and injuries. Always check the weight of the load before lifting and use the appropriate sling with the correct weight capacity.

Another mistake to avoid is using damaged or worn-out Slings. Inspect the sling before each use for any signs of wear, such as fraying or kinks. If any damage is found, replace the sling immediately to prevent accidents. Regular inspections and maintenance of the slings are essential to ensure their safety and longevity.

Improper rigging of the sling is another common mistake that can occur. It is important to follow the manufacturer’s guidelines for rigging the sling properly. Make sure the sling is securely attached to the load and the crane, using the correct Hardware and attachments. Improper rigging can cause the load to shift or fall, leading to accidents and injuries.

Neglecting to use proper lifting techniques is also a mistake to avoid when using wire rope sling legs in overhead crane applications. Always use the correct lifting procedures, such as lifting the load slowly and smoothly to prevent sudden movements. Avoid jerking or swinging the load, as this can put stress on the sling and cause it to fail. Proper training and supervision of crane operators are essential to ensure safe lifting practices.

Using the wrong type of sling for the job is another mistake that can compromise safety. There are different types of wire rope slings available, each designed for specific applications. Make sure to use the appropriate sling for the type of load being lifted, whether it is a single-leg sling, double-leg sling, or multi-leg sling. Using the wrong type of sling can lead to accidents and damage to the equipment.

Neglecting to inspect the crane and rigging equipment is another common mistake that can have serious consequences. Regular inspections of the crane, slings, and attachments are essential to ensure their safety and functionality. Look for any signs of wear, corrosion, or damage and address them promptly. Proper maintenance and inspection of the equipment can prevent accidents and ensure the safety of everyone involved.
